This specialist school in Birmingham is looking to appoint a committed SEND Teacher to join their team for a September 2026 start.

As a SEND Teacher, you will teach small classes of pupils with a range of special educational needs, including complex learning needs, Autism, communication impairments and physical disabilities. You will deliver a highly personalised curriculum that supports academic progress, communication, independence and life skills development. The school offers a nurturing and structured environment where pupils are encouraged to thrive at their own pace.

You will work closely with experienced Teaching Assistants, therapists and senior leaders to create engaging learning experiences tailored to individual needs. This is an excellent opportunity for a teacher who wants to make a genuine difference in a rewarding specialist setting.

This role would suit a qualified teacher with QTS and a genuine interest in SEND. Previous experience teaching in a SEND or complex needs school is desirable but not essential.

✨Know Your SEND Stuff

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of special educational needs and complex needs. Familiarise yourself with different conditions like Autism and communication impairments, as well as effective teaching strategies tailored for these learners. This will show your passion and commitment to the role.

✨Showcase Your Personalised Approach

Prepare to discuss how you would create a highly personalised curriculum for your students. Think about specific examples from your past experiences where you've successfully differentiated lessons or supported individual learning needs. This will demonstrate your ability to adapt and cater to diverse learners.

✨Teamwork Makes the Dream Work

Highlight your experience working collaboratively with Teaching Assistants and other professionals. Be ready to share examples of how you've effectively communicated and partnered with others to enhance student learning. This is crucial in a specialist setting where teamwork is key.

✨Engage with Practical Strategies

Think about sensory, practical, and creative approaches you can use to engage learners. Prepare to discuss specific activities or methods you've used in the past that have worked well for students with complex needs. This will show your innovative side and your readiness to create engaging learning experiences.
